## Service Accounts — StormFan Alert Fan-Out

The fan-out worker authenticates to the internal dispatch tier using the svc-stormfan account. Rotate quarterly; scopes are limited to publish-only on alert topics. If deliveries stall during your shift, verify the worker is using the current credential, reproduced below for reference.

API key for kaweg-hahif: kto4_rAjZ

Subject: Cut-over complete — Mirefield incremental rebuilds

Hi all,

Quick recap: we flipped Mirefield's static site pipeline to incremental rebuilds last night. Full rebuilds are now reserved for schema changes; everything else goes through the Ashloom differ, which cut median publish time from nine minutes to about forty seconds. From a security angle, the build workers now run with a narrower token scope, and the cache bucket is private. For your review, the settings we went live with are below.

deployment values, fahap-hahaf:
[casdor]
port = 9200
region = south-2
host = casdor.qirvanworks.corp
timeout_ms = 3000
retries = 4

# Break-Glass: Catalog Cache Invalidation

Scope: the Pinrow product catalog at Veldstone Retail. If stale prices persist after a purge and the Hollowmere invalidation queue is wedged, use break-glass to flush the edge tier directly. Contractors: get verbal sign-off from the catalog lead first. Steps: open the Hollowmere admin shell, select emergency-flush, confirm the tenant, and run it once — repeated flushes thrash the origin. Access is logged and expires after 20 minutes. Unseal the admin shell with the passphrase below.

recovery phrase for kahop-tajog: istix-casvan